Electrodynamic Simulation of High-Voltage Peaking Switch
TL;DR: In this article, the authors discussed the modeling of a peaking switch to study the reduction in rise time for the sub-nanosecond duration pulses and the effect of various shapes of input pulse, inductance, and interelectrode distance on the output voltage and wave shape.

System Design of Fast Actuator for Vacuum Interrupter in DC Applications

TL;DR: In this article, a Thomson coil actuator system for a vacuum interrupter is designed, where active damping is used to decelerate the moving contacts and the design philosophy is explained and FEM simulation results are presented.
New Sensor for Medium- and High-Voltage Measurement

TL;DR: A sensor that can be installed directly on a wire and can operate without a galvanic connection to the ground may be used as an alternative voltage measurement device, which can complement current sensors installed on a Wire, forming a complete power acquisition system.
